I think that part of the issue is, the optiplex bezel is a very course plastic, and has all the dimples in the plastic itself.
ooohhhh, well, if that is the case, then I would suggest using a very coarse sandpaper to start out with (250 or 350) and sand out all those little coarse bumps in the plastic. Then finish it off with 400 and 600 (and maybe even 800) grit to get it nice and smooth for the paint. It will probably look much better. Luckily, plastic sands pretty easy
